Preparing for an electrical incident involves multiple components, as safety and readiness can significantly reduce risks to personnel and property. Having a first aid kit available is crucial because it ensures that immediate medical assistance can be provided in case of an accident. Electrical incidents can lead to injuries, and possessing the necessary medical supplies allows for prompt and effective response to injuries that might occur.

Practicing electrical safety drills is equally important as it familiarizes individuals with emergency procedures. These drills help staff understand how to react during an electrical incident, including evacuation routes and communication protocols. Regular practice ensures that individuals can act quickly and efficiently and minimizes panic during a real event.

The combination of both components—having a first aid kit and engaging in safety drills—constitutes a comprehensive approach to preparation for electrical incidents. Ensuring both tools and training are available maximizes the effectiveness of the emergency response.
